5 Must-Try Indian Dishes You Must Binge on At Dosa Hut in Harris Park
For the tandoor lovers - Chicken Tikka
North Indian starters are all about richness and bold flavours, and one such unmissable preparation is Chicken Tikka. Marinated in a mixture of yoghurt and spices, the chicken pieces are skewered and cooked in a tandoor (clay oven). The charred exterior and the juicy interior make this dish a favourite on the menu. Further, the smoky flavour of the Chicken Tikka, when paired with the zesty mint chutney, enhances the overall dining experience.

For creamy bliss - Dal Makhani
This highly adored North Indian curry is popular for its creamy texture, balanced flavours, and rich ingredients. The magic of this vegetarian curry lies in its preparation technique, where the lentils and beans are simmered on low heat and allowed to absorb all the flavours. Further, the curry is cooked till it achieves a velvety texture. The addition of butter and cream towards the end of the cooking gives it a rich and comforting feel.
Dal Makhani is one of the most loved vegetarian curries that can be eaten with Indian bread or as a side dish. You can also pair this wonderful curry with plain rice! Filled with the goodness of lentils and beans, this curry is hard to resist.

A flavourful street food sensation - Pav Bhaji
Pav Bhaji is a popular street food from Mumbai, India. This dish has captured the hearts and tastebuds of food lovers all over the world. The bhaji in this dish consists of a flavourful vegetable mash of boiled potatoes, peas, tomatoes, onions, and a blend of spices. Served with soft buttered buns toasted to perfection, Pav Bhaji is both comforting and satisfying.

Of royal and majestic flavours - Chicken Dum Biryani
This list is incomplete without the mention of Chicken Dum Biryani. This royal dish hails from the kitchens of the Mughals and has become a symbol of culinary excellence. Dosa Hut serves authentic Chicken Dum Biryani. In this dish, the luxurious combination of rice, flavourful chicken pieces marinated in yogurt and spices, and herbs, are layered and slow-cooked to perfection. Further, fried onions and strands of saffron are added to the final dish to enhance the complexity and richness of the preparation.

South India’s culinary marvel - Masala Dosa
The humble Masala Dosa comes with simple flavours, but its appeal is anything but ordinary. This iconic South Indian dish has a crispy golden outer texture and flavourful potato filling.
With the perfect balance of taste, texture, and tradition, Masala Dosa is a masterpiece. A breakfast staple in India, this dish can be eaten for snacks or a wholesome meal. Usually served with sambar and chutney, Masala Dosa is apt for those who like to have light meals.

Kizhi Porotta: A Culinary Delight from South India
Kizhi Porotta, a traditional South Indian dish, is gaining popularity not only in its place of origin but also across the globe. This unique dish, known for its flavorful taste and distinctive preparation method, has become a favorite among food enthusiasts. Let’s delve into the fascinating world of Kizhi Porotta and explore its origins, ingredients, preparation method, and where you can enjoy it, including the best South Indian restaurants offering Indian lunch buffets in Edmonton.
Origin and History
Kizhi Porotta traces its roots back to the southern state of Kerala in India. It originated in the Malabar region, known for its rich culinary heritage. The term “Kizhi” refers to the process of tying or wrapping, while “Porotta” denotes a layered flatbread made from refined flour. This dish has been a part of Kerala’s culinary tradition for centuries, with its recipe passed down through generations.
Ingredients Used in Kizhi Porotta
The primary ingredients used in making Kizhi Porotta include:
Refined flour (maida)
Water
Salt
Ghee or oil
Preparation Method
To prepare Kizhi Porotta, the dough is kneaded using refined flour, water, and salt until it reaches a soft consistency. The dough is then divided into small portions, rolled into thin layers, and layered with ghee or oil. These thin layers are then stacked together and rolled into a cylindrical shape. The cylindrical dough is then wrapped in a banana leaf or cloth and steamed or baked until cooked thoroughly.
Unique Features of Kizhi Porotta
What sets Kizhi Porotta apart is its unique preparation method. The layers of dough, coupled with the use of ghee or oil, result in a flaky and aromatic flatbread with a soft texture. The steaming or baking process enhances the flavors, making it a delightful culinary experience.
Kizhi Porotta Variations
While the traditional Kizhi Porotta recipe remains popular, several variations have emerged over time. Some variations include stuffing the porotta with minced meat, vegetables, or eggs, adding a new dimension to its taste and texture.
